Transaction 43dd2e6253c2161f764b852390bbd802bc4fd0fedb0723ec9edeb806940427dc

7 Input
2 Outputs
  • 43dd2e6253c2161f764b852390bbd802bc4fd0fedb0723ec9edeb806940427dc:0
  • value  16580000
    address  19W7Yd9pbZQZdkPL5G86mm2fixgSjuFVEr
  • 43dd2e6253c2161f764b852390bbd802bc4fd0fedb0723ec9edeb806940427dc:1
  • value  1000274
    address  18R4m6FvkXHNj7sQ7fEastVcSbCu3w3bNu